KR Market
Proceed to Asia's largest flower market. Experience vibrant colors and scents, a typical local Indian market's hustle and bustle, get to know how a typical day is for a local vendor The market itself is steeped in history, having been established during the British era. You'll see the colonial architecture of the market building and nearby structures, giving you a glimpse into Bangalore's past. Even more importantly, explore the market's captivating history and .. much more as we walk

Bangalore Fort
The Bangalore Fort, a historic site that dates back to the Kempe Gowda era. It's small but a significant fort with lot of history

Kote Venkataramana Temple
The Kote Venkataraman Temple one of the oldest temple in Bangalore was built in the early 17th century during the reign of the Mysore Wodeyars. The temple is a classic example of Dravidian architecture
